【Axure笔记】7。文本框和文本字段:如何获取输入框中的文本?
首先要明确文本框的获取原理——核心是Axure交互中“组件文本”的选项。用上图的例子,我们来详细分析一下:
1.?我们需要用户能够输入文本,拖动一个文本框(文本字段)到其中,并将其命名为文本字段。
2.?我们要对取出的文本做什么?我还使用了最简单的方法直接在一个矩形中显示文本(名为Placehold),你当然可以在repeater中填充这个文本,将它赋给全局变量等等。
3.?我们什么时候需要提取用户输入的文本?最简单的方法是拖入一个按钮,当用户点击它时,我们可以获得用户输入的文本,并根据2将文本显示在矩形中。当然,您可以将其设置为任何其他复杂的情况,例如当打开一个新的页面链接时,当显示或隐藏一个组件时获取文本,等等。这里只用最简单方便的按钮来表示。
1.2.3的原理我们已经明白了,下面详细写下来。
?方法1:当用户按下按钮时,我们向按钮添加交互。鼠标点击时,设置目标“Placehold”设置为“text”。单击价值线右侧的fx按钮。点击后,在编辑功能的新窗口向下看,点击添加局部变量,设置“LVAR1”为“组件文本”。你以后会选择谁的组件文本?当然,Textfiled是输入框。
然后选择上面的插入变量或函数并选择“LVAR1”,点击确定完成。
方法二:在前面的方法一中,仍然在按钮上添加交互,但是在鼠标点击时,将目标Placehold设置为“组件文本”,可以直接选择目标为Textfiled,简单高效。
可能是汉化的缘故吧。新手看到方法1中“文本”的设置时,第一印象是固定为文本框中的文本,但后来需要填写值时,却因为对函数编写不熟练而感到困惑,找不到菜单中隐藏的更简单的“组件文本”选项。
——————————————————————————————————————————————————————————————————————————————————————————————————————————————————————————————————————————————————————————————————————————————————
第1章
开始前的准备
1.?它写在前面。我为什么要打开pit Axure?
2.?没有一个完整的想法就直接从一个产品中借鉴是耍流氓。
3.?三思而后行:高保真还是低保真?
4.我们还是要稍微了解一下移动端的相关规格。
章?2
开始吧,初学者的愚蠢问题:
5.?站在巨人的肩膀上:先装一个组件库。
6.?技能多了不算重,组件多了才是真的重。
7.文本框和文本字段:如何获取输入的文本?
8.如何使用url和变量链接页面和跳转?
9.?关于命名约定:页面、组件、组。
10.什么时候应该使用动态面板?
11.?什么时候应该使用中继器?
12.交互作用、变量和函数。我应该如何开始学习?
13.互动情境的最后一道防线
第三章
实用课程,未完待续。...